Transaction 33cedda75f83c96f66fc6d2aaded6f51b97a4ad58fb6ea0d1cb79a347b8c40f2
2 Input
2 Outputs
- 33cedda75f83c96f66fc6d2aaded6f51b97a4ad58fb6ea0d1cb79a347b8c40f2:0
- 33cedda75f83c96f66fc6d2aaded6f51b97a4ad58fb6ea0d1cb79a347b8c40f2:1
value 8500000
address 3MM36y8LeN6QHDwnTb88Hvhs1wDERU2mty
value 20569303
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n